Until recently, blind or partially blind students in Kenya were still using braille books for their studies.
4
The braille system uses bumps to represent words on pages.
5
Blind people can learn to feel these bumps and recognize words.
6
But Kenyan schools for the blind are now beginning to use technology that provides material in an audible form.
7
This has taught students new ways to interact with technology.
8
17-year-old Lucas Wanzia is visually impaired.
9
For the last two years,
10
he has been attending computer classes at the Thika School for the Blind.
11
Wanzia started school at a later age because of his vision.
12
But using the new technology,
13
he can search the internet for biology class.
14
The technology also has decreased his costs.
15
He says Braille books are expensive,
16
but there is little or no cost to virtual books.
17
The school started using assistive technology six years ago.
18
It permits blind and visually impaired students to get information from computers and iPads.
19
THIKA teacher Zachary Wasia has been helping students learn how to use the technology for about two years now.
20
He says the technology presents opportunities that can level the playing field for his students.
21
The assistive technology costs $1,000 for a school to put in place.
22
But a non-governmental organization, an NGO called Enable,
23
has provided it to the schools at no cost.
24
Four out of Kenya's 11 schools for the blind have adopted the technology.
25
Enable says it will provide funding for the remaining schools to join the effort.

什么是跟读法?

跟读法 (Shadowing) 是一种有科学依据的语言学习技巧,最初开发用于专业口译员的培训,并由多语言者Alexander Arguelles博士普及。这个方法简单而强大:您在听英语母语原声的同时立即大声重复——就像是一个延迟1-2秒紧跟说话者的影子。与被动听力或语法练习不同,跟读法强迫您的大脑和口腔肌肉同时处理并模仿真实的讲话模式。研究表明它能显着提高发音准确性,语调,节奏,连读,听力理解和口语流利度——使其成为雅思口语备考和真实英语交流最有效的方法之一。
